Language: Phan Rang Cham (Eastern Cham)

Source/Author:  Various sources, Moussay 1971, Thurgood 1999 
Identifiers:  ISO-639-3:cjm  Glottocode: east2563 
Notes:  The original orthographies have been standardized (see Appendix in Thurgood 1999). The records are old and varied.

Moussay, Gerard (1971). Dictionnaire Cam-Vietnamien-Français. Phan Rang: Centre Culturel Cam.

Thurgood, G. (1999) From Ancient Cham to Modern Dialects: Two Thousand Years of Language Contact and Change. Hawaii: University of Hawaii Press. 
Problems:  The orthography used below both ignores vowel length and uses b, d, g to indicate a slightly breathy following vowel, rather than a voiced consonant
